Early Poems by Sacha Black Almanac. # 1. 1906./Rannie stikhotvoreniya Sashi Chernogo Almanakh. # 1. 1906 god. Ya. Balyanskys typography. Editor-publisher V.S. Chekhonin. St. Petersburg, 1906. The magazine contains two poems by Sacha Cherny: Who Lives Fun and Balbes. The Almanac is a monthly literary and artistic illustrated magazine of political satire. The Renaissance Society of America. 1966. In-8. Broché. Bon état, Couv. convenable, Dos satisfaisant, Intérieur frais. 287 pages.. . . . Classification Dewey : 420-Langue anglaise. Anglo-saxon
CONTENTS: Economic Change and the Emerging Florentine Territorial State, MARVIN B. BECKER. The Unknown Quattrocento Poetics of Bartolommeo della Fonte, CHARLES TRINKAUS. Some Early Poems of Antonio Geraldini, J. F. C. Richards (addendum by James Hutton). Reginald Pecock and the Renaissance Sense of History, ARTHUR B. FERGUSON. The Medieval Origins of the Sixteenth-century English Jest-books, STANLEY J. KAHRL. Legal Humanism and the Sense of History, DONALD R. KELLEY. The Pedagogy of Johann Sturm (1507-1589) and its Evangelical Inspiration, PIERRE MESNARD. Ambiguity in Writings on Humanistic Education: Text Criticism and the Concept of Man: Supplementary Remarks, OTTO HERDING. The Rejection of Learning in Mid-Cinquecento Italy, PAUL F. GRENDLER. The Limits of Toleration in Sixteenth-century France, E. M. BEAME. Paradox in Donne, MICHAEL McCANLES. Classification Dewey : 420-Langue anglaise. Anglo-saxon
Thomas Y. Crowell & Co 1893 in12. 1893. Cartonné. Ce recueil rassemble les premiers poèmes de John Greenleaf Whittier poète américain du XIXe siècle. Il est notamment connu pour son engagement dans le mouvement abolitionniste utilisant sa poésie comme une voix efficace dans la lutte contre l'esclavage. L'ouvrage comprend également une esquisse biographique de l'auteur
